电脑编程配置深度解析:从入门到进阶的硬件与软件选择110


对于想要学习编程或从事编程相关工作的朋友来说,拥有一台合适的电脑至关重要。 电脑配置的好坏直接影响到编程效率、开发体验以及项目的编译速度。 本文将深入探讨电脑写编程配置的各个方面,从入门级到专业级,帮助你选择最合适的硬件和软件,打造属于你的编程利器。

一、 处理器 (CPU): 编程的“大脑”

CPU是电脑的核心部件,负责处理所有指令。对于编程来说,CPU的核心数、主频和缓存大小都至关重要。多核处理器能够更好地处理并行任务,例如编译大型项目或运行多个虚拟机。高主频则意味着更快的指令执行速度。较大的缓存能够减少CPU访问内存的次数,提升效率。入门级编程可以选择四核处理器,例如Intel i5或AMD Ryzen 5系列。对于专业级编程,例如游戏开发、人工智能或数据科学,则建议选择八核或更多核心的处理器,例如Intel i7、i9或AMD Ryzen 7、Ryzen 9系列,甚至更高端的线程撕裂者系列。

二、 内存 (RAM): 编程的“工作台”

内存是电脑用来临时存储数据的部件,编程过程中需要频繁地读取和写入数据。内存容量直接影响到程序运行速度和多任务处理能力。内存不足会导致程序卡顿、崩溃甚至系统崩溃。对于一般的编程任务,8GB内存已经足够,但如果进行大型项目开发、运行虚拟机或使用大型IDE,则建议至少16GB,甚至32GB或更大。 内存速度也是一个重要因素,更高的频率意味着更快的读写速度,可以提升整体性能。建议选择DDR4或DDR5内存。

三、 存储 (SSD/HDD): 编程的“资料库”

存储设备用来存放操作系统、软件和项目文件。现在主流的存储设备是固态硬盘(SSD)和机械硬盘(HDD)。SSD具有极快的读写速度,能够显著缩短程序加载时间和编译时间。HDD则价格相对便宜,但速度较慢。建议至少配备一个SSD作为系统盘和常用软件的安装盘,提高系统响应速度。如果需要存储大量数据,可以额外配备一个HDD作为数据存储盘。

四、 显卡 (GPU): 编程的“加速器”(部分场景)

对于大多数编程任务,显卡的需求并不高,集成显卡通常就足够了。但是,在一些特定领域,例如游戏开发、机器学习和深度学习,显卡的作用就非常重要了。 高性能的独立显卡能够加速计算过程,显著缩短项目开发时间。选择显卡时需要考虑显存容量和CUDA核心数等因素。 入门级可以选择入门级的独立显卡,例如GTX 1650或RX 6500 XT;专业级则可以选择RTX 30系列或RX 6000系列甚至更高端的专业显卡。

五、 显示器:编程的“窗口”

一个好的显示器能够提升编程效率和舒适度。建议选择至少24英寸的显示器,分辨率越高越好,例如1080P或更高。此外,还要注意显示器的色准和刷新率。 对于长时间编程,建议选择护眼功能的显示器,减少眼睛疲劳。

六、 软件配置:编程的“工具箱”

除了硬件,合适的软件配置也至关重要。你需要选择合适的编程语言IDE(集成开发环境),例如VS Code、IntelliJ IDEA、Eclipse、PyCharm等。 这些IDE提供了代码编辑、调试、版本控制等功能,能够大大提高编程效率。此外,还需要安装必要的编译器、解释器、数据库软件以及其他开发工具。

七、 预算与选择建议:

根据不同的编程需求和预算,可以选择不同的配置。入门级编程可以选择性价比高的配置,例如i5处理器、8GB内存、512GB SSD。中端配置可以选择i7处理器、16GB内存、1TB SSD。专业级配置则可以选择i9处理器、32GB内存以上,搭配高速SSD和高端独立显卡。

总结:

选择合适的电脑配置对于编程至关重要。在配置电脑时,需要根据自身的需求和预算,合理选择CPU、内存、存储、显卡等硬件,并安装合适的软件。希望本文能够帮助你更好地了解电脑编程配置,打造属于你的高效编程环境。

2025-05-09


上一篇:软件编程与电脑软件:从代码到应用的奇妙旅程

下一篇:模具电脑编程:从设计图纸到完美产品,全流程深度解析